How to prevent Shipping and Total from Displaying when SameAs (billing) clicked

The issue is the following:

If someone ads to cart, gets to the checkout page, hits 'Same as billing' checkbox, it calculates the shipping. Fine. However, if they go back to the shopping list (because they want to add something else at that point (for any reason), then add something else, then get back to checkout, the Shipping totals retains the original shipping amt. instead of the updated amt, which will only update on the next screen (after pressing 'Continue' btn.

That is the reason I wanted to Not Display the Shipping (and the Grand Total (only the subtotal), until that page. (it looks like it stays on the Checkout.php page but simply Includes the Confirm.php, which in turn Includes the Confirm_cart.php page.)

I am able to hide the fields with css of course (named eC_SummaryShipping and eC_SummaryFooter (this latter one I added as it wasn't there for the tr).Tried hiding on checkout.php and showing on confirm.php with css 'visibility', but, I can't make it reappear after pressing 'Continue'. So it'ls hidden for good.

(I also tried with JQuery, but can't make it reappear).

But that is our dilema.
